Post-construction termite treatment is used after a building's conclusion to protect versus termite infestation. This treatment typically includes soil applications of termiticides around the foundation or the installation of baiting systems to produce a protective barrier. Post-construction treatments need mindful planning to avoid damage to structures and guarantee efficient protection, and they are frequently part of a extensive termite management program including regular assessments
